The hidden rock carvings at Crantock beach
Crantock Beach near Newquay is well known for having numerous caves which can be seen at low tide.
One of those caves, called Piper's Hole, holds the secret of a woman's face and a poem carved in the stone.
Elizabeth Dale, who writes about local history as the Cornish Bird Blogger first wrote about this cave in 2016 and then uncovered more information as she has been telling Emma Gill.
